Popular Crafts for Kids

Crafting activities encourage creativity and imagination in children. Various projects exist, ranging from simple to more complex, making them suitable for different age groups.

Paper Crafts

Paper crafts engage children with easy-to-find materials. Origami, for instance, introduces kids to basic folding techniques that create intricate designs. Scrapbooking allows children to express themselves by arranging photos and decorative elements. Collage-making invites imaginative combinations of various paper types, including magazines and colored sheets. Drawing and painting with paper encourages artistic exploration. Each project helps develop fine motor skills while fostering a love for creativity.

Nature Crafts

Nature crafts utilize outdoor resources to inspire creativity. Collecting leaves, flowers, and twigs leads to opportunities for making unique art pieces. Leaf rubbings capture the textures and shapes of different leaves, enhancing observational skills. Nature-themed dioramas transform shoeboxes into imaginative landscapes. Painting stones adds a personal touch to gardens or playgrounds. Each activity promotes an appreciation for nature while encouraging hands-on learning about the environment.

Recycled Crafts

Recycled crafts focus on reusing materials and promoting environmental awareness. Empty containers can be transformed into flower pots or organizers, showcasing creativity in repurposing. Cardboard boxes often become part of imaginative sculptures or playhouses, fostering inventive play. Plastic bottles can be turned into bird feeders, encouraging wildlife interaction. Scrap fabric or old clothing lends itself to sewing projects, like plush toys or upcycled bags. Each recycled project teaches kids about sustainability and inspires resourcefulness.

Choosing the Right Materials

Choosing the right materials ensures safe and enjoyable crafting experiences for kids. Selecting appropriate supplies encourages creativity while minimizing risks.

Safe and Non-Toxic Options

Safety takes precedence when choosing crafting materials. Non-toxic glue, crayons, and paints are essential for children’s projects. Several brands offer products labeled as child-safe, providing peace of mind for parents. Opting for water-based paints reduces harmful chemical exposure. It’s smart to check labels for safety certifications, ensuring materials meet safety standards. When selecting items like scissors or other tools, look for those designed specifically for children. Prioritizing these options fosters a healthy crafting environment, allowing kids to express themselves freely without unnecessary hazards.

Tips for Successful Crafting

Crafting success hinges on proper preparation and encouragement. Attention to detail during setup can significantly enhance the crafting experience for kids.

Setting Up a Craft Space

Creating an organized craft space optimizes creativity. Designate a specific area with ample room and accessible supplies. Include essentials like paper, scissors, and glue in easily reachable containers. Ensure proper lighting brightens the workspace, fostering a welcoming atmosphere. Reducing distractions helps children focus better, enhancing their crafting experience. Additionally, a clean surface allows freedom for exploration and experimentation without the worry of mess.

Encouraging Imagination

Fostering imagination is crucial for engaging young crafters. Present open-ended prompts that stimulate creativity; rather than providing step-by-step instructions, suggest themes like animals or nature. Allow children to choose colors and materials freely, promoting personal expression. Challenge them to think critically about their designs, encouraging unique approaches to crafting. Reinforcing their ideas boosts confidence, further enhancing their desire to create. Providing positive feedback inspires continued exploration and creativity in future projects.
